jq动态增加li
时间: 2023-07-26 09:24:26 浏览: 62
要动态增加一个 `li` 元素,可以使用 jQuery 的 `append()` 方法。例如,如果要在 `ul` 元素中增加一个新的 `li` 元素,可以按照以下方式编写代码:
```javascript
// 获取需要增加 li 的 ul 元素
var ulElement = $('ul');
// 创建一个新的 li 元素
var newLiElement = $('<li>New Item</li>');
// 将新的 li 元素添加到 ul 元素中
ulElement.append(newLiElement);
```
这样就可以动态增加一个新的 `li` 元素到 `ul` 元素中了。如果需要增加多个 `li` 元素,可以将上面的代码放在一个循环中,按需重复执行即可。
相关问题
用jq增加的li进行删除
使用 jQuery 的 remove 方法可以删除指定的元素。你可以先选中要删除的 li 元素,然后调用 remove 方法即可删除该元素。示例代码如下:
```javascript
// 选中要删除的 li 元素
var liToRemove = $("li");
// 删除 li 元素
liToRemove.remove();
```
在上面的代码中,我们首先使用 `$` 函数选中要删除的 li 元素,并将其赋值给变量 `liToRemove`。然后,我们调用 `remove` 方法删除该元素。该方法会将选中的元素从 DOM 树中彻底删除,包括其所有的子元素和绑定的事件。
如果你想要删除所有的 li 元素,可以使用以下代码:
```javascript
// 删除所有的 li 元素
$("li").remove();
```
该代码会选中所有的 li 元素,并将其从 DOM 树中彻底删除。
用jq进行li增加样式
可以使用以下的 jq 代码来为 li 元素增加样式:
```javascript
$("li").addClass("class-name");
```
其中,class-name 是你想要添加的样式类名,可以根据你的需要进行修改。此代码会为所有的 li 元素添加该样式类。如果你只想为某个具体的 li 元素添加该样式类,可以将选择器修改为该元素的 ID 或者类名等具体标识。